The Colorado River, explained simply

No jargon. About five minutes. What is actually going wrong, and the surprisingly practical way to fix it.

A hundred years ago, seven states signed a deal to split the Colorado River. They split up more water than the river actually carries.

For decades, two giant reservoirs, Lake Mead and Lake Powell, hid the gap. Think of them as enormous savings accounts of water. Everyone quietly overdrew them, year after year. Now those accounts are close to empty, and the overdraft is finally coming due.

The good news is that the problem is more measurable, and more fixable, than the headlines suggest. Here is the whole thing in four facts.

The four facts

What the data actually shows

01

The water nobody counts

Every year a huge amount of water simply evaporates off the reservoirs or leaks away. It adds up to more than a million acre-feet, enough for several million homes. Here is the strange part. No state is charged for it. It just disappears from the books. Fixing the river starts with something boring and powerful: actually measuring this.

02

It is draining underground too

Satellites can weigh the water in the ground from space. They show the whole basin drying out. Not only the lakes you can see, but the groundwater underneath that no law even tracks. Those losses are real and mostly do not come back.

03

We grow the cheap thing with it

Most of the river’s water grows cattle feed, hay and alfalfa. That water produces about $360 of crop per acre-foot. Cities and industry would pay roughly ten times more for the same water. So the scarcest water in the West is being spent on its lowest-value use.

04

The dams are warming the river

As the reservoirs drop, the water released from the dams comes out warmer. It is now too warm, for months each year, for the native fish, and warm enough to help invasive bass take over the Grand Canyon. Low water is not only a supply problem. It is a temperature problem.

The fix, in one idea

Two moves, done together.

One: pay people to use less water. Pay farmers to leave some fields fallow or irrigate more efficiently, and prove the savings with satellites so nobody can game it. Paying to conserve is far cheaper than building anything new.

Two: build cheap desert solar right next to the dams. Reuse the power lines that are already there. That solar backs up the dams as they lose power, feeds the data centers everyone is building anyway, and runs the machines that make more water through recycling and desalination.

The companies blamed for draining the desert become the ones who help refill the river. Not charity. Infrastructure that pays for itself.

Why it is affordable

It costs about what insurance costs

The river supports roughly a $1.5 trillion economy and 16 million jobs across seven states and Mexico. Stabilizing it costs a tiny slice of that, well under one percent a year.

Think of it as insurance on something you cannot afford to lose. The expensive option is doing nothing and letting the whole thing keep eroding.
